Women mean business
By Leigh Hunt on May 21st, 2007
I was just having a read of Lea Woodward’s blog and came across this news story on her site. It notes that women aged 18 - 34 account for 18% of all online activity in the UK.
According to an American statistic, 80% of all purchases are made by women. As such a force in the consumer market, it’s no surprise we’re starting to make our mark in business. By becoming a more dominant contingent in the business world, we truly have the power to create a better balance between family and work and a revolution in how business is done.
